  1. solve each of the following proportions for the variables given without the use of a calculator.

(a) \\(\frac{c}{8}=6\\)
(b) \\(\frac{x}{14}=\frac{3}{7}\\)
(c) \\(\frac{36}{m}=\frac{12}{5}\\)

  1. solve each of the following proportions using a calculator to aid in calculations.

(a) \\(\frac{a}{39}=\frac{1.4}{6}\\)
(b) \\(\frac{377}{x}=\frac{13}{5}\\)
(c) \\(\frac{10}{3}=\frac{115}{c}\\)
using your math (use a calculator to help)

  1. rachel is getting a sundae where the cost is proportional to the weight of the sundae she makes. last time rachel went she bought a 12 - ounce sundae for $4.20. this time she buys a 17 - ounce sundae. let c be the cost of the sundae. set up and solve a proportion for c.

Explanation:

Step1: Cross-multiply to isolate $c$

$\frac{c}{8}=6 \implies c=6 \times 8$

Step2: Calculate the value of $c$

$c=48$

---

Step1: Cross-multiply to isolate $x$

$\frac{x}{14}=\frac{3}{7} \implies 7x=14 \times 3$

Step2: Simplify right-hand side

$7x=42$

Step3: Solve for $x$

$x=\frac{42}{7}=6$

---

Step1: Cross-multiply to isolate $m$

$\frac{36}{m}=\frac{12}{5} \implies 12m=36 \times 5$

Step2: Simplify right-hand side

$12m=180$

Step3: Solve for $m$

$m=\frac{180}{12}=15$

---

Step1: Cross-multiply to isolate $x$

$\frac{377}{x}=\frac{13}{5} \implies 13x=377 \times 5$

Step2: Simplify right-hand side

$13x=1885$

Step3: Solve for $x$

$x=\frac{1885}{13}=145$

---

Step1: Cross-multiply to isolate $c$

$\frac{10}{3}=\frac{115}{c} \implies 10c=3 \times 115$

Step2: Simplify right-hand side

$10c=345$

Step3: Solve for $c$

$c=\frac{345}{10}=34.5$

---

Step1: Set up proportional equation

$\frac{\text{Cost}}{\text{Weight}} = \frac{4.20}{12}=\frac{c}{17}$

Step2: Cross-multiply to isolate $c$

$12c=4.20 \times 17$

Step3: Simplify right-hand side

$12c=71.4$

Step4: Solve for $c$

$c=\frac{71.4}{12}=5.95$
